Is Jason in the same universe as Michael Myers?

In the end, though, they are completely separate characters. Michael Myers was from a small indie film by John Carpenter which grew so popular that it spawned a franchise. Jason Voorhees was a small but important character reintroduced in a sequel, who grew to become the most popular icon in slasher fiction.

also Who came first Jason or Michael Myers? While it is probably true that both horror movie franchise giants have ‘borrowed’ a little from one anotheru2026the truth is, Halloween actually came first. John Carpenter’s original Halloween was filmed in 1978 and featured the ruthless killer Michael Myers in a nearly polished fashion right away.

Is Michael Myers real face? Michael Myers is a fictional character from the Halloween series of slasher films. … In the first two films, Michael wears a Captain Kirk mask that is painted white. The mask, which was made from a cast of William Shatner’s face, was originally used in the 1975 horror film The Devil’s Rain.

How big is Michael Myers in Halloween kills?

James Jude Courtney, the main actor playing Michael Myers is 6’3″ tall. Nick Castle who played the original role in 1978 is slightly smaller at 5’10” tall. Tyler Mane, who played Michael in the sequel, Halloween (2007), is 6’9″, meaning he was close to being over 7′ tall.

Is Michael Myers in Halloween 3? Halloween III: Season of the Witch is something of a red-headed stepchild in the vaunted franchise. … It’s the only Halloween movie not focused on Michael Myers, which became a part of its odd appeal that led to its eventual status as a cult classic.
